Canon RF-S 55-210mm F5-7.1 IS STM Lens
Get closer - everywhere
Bring distant subjects closer and unleash your creativity with this lightweight and versatile telephoto zoom for APS-C sensor cameras.

Extended range
Capture distant details and landscapes as well as great travel moments and take flattering, full-frame portraits. With the Lens' telephoto range, you can blur the background to make your subjects stand out. This 3.8x zoom lens with a focal length of 55-210mm offers enormous creative possibilities.

Get close, even when you're far away
With a turn of the zoom ring, you can see details that were previously hidden from you. With a focal length of 210mm, the RF-S 55-210mm F5-7.1 IS STM offers a maximum magnification of 0.28x, allowing you to focus in close without disturbing the subject or casting shadows - perfect for spontaneous close-ups.

Advanced image stabilization
Ready to use immediately - even in low light - and with super-stable results right into the telephoto range thanks to the 4.5-stop optical image stabilizer.

Get creative with beautiful highlights and bokeh
The practically circular 7-blade iris diaphragm enables beautiful out-of-focus light effects (bokeh), and the telephoto setting with a wide-open aperture provides an attractive background blur that clearly highlights the subject, giving the image a very special effect.

Smooth, steady focusing with intuitive control
Thanks to the combined lens ring, which both controls the settings and can be used for manual focusing, you can quickly switch between different modes to shoot and film like a pro. The STM focusing motor in the lens works almost silently.

A lens that works intuitively with an EOS R camera
Thanks to the RF bayonet, the RF-S 55-210mm F5-7.1 IS STM works seamlessly with EOS R series cameras to perform a variety of image optimizations in real time - including focus breathing correction in video mode.
